If Ned had left right after Robert dismissed him, then the War of the 5 Kings does not take place.  Ned does not warn Cersie he knows of the incest, Robert isn't killed, and Ned isn't imprisoned.

If Ned isn't imprisoned, then Rob doesn't call the banners, etc...

The Mountain's attack on the Riverlands is dealt with by Robert, not Ned.

Ned would never have accepted a crown and would have supported Stannis instead. So no king in the North. Without his public "confession" Ned would still be a man people respected, so if he supported Stannis I think he might have had significantly more support. 

With Ned alive I think its unlikely that Balon launches his war either, nor would Theon be send back to the Iron Islands.

So at most it would be the War of Three Kings.
